npc_human_grunt is a point entity available in Black Mesa Black Mesa.

They are part of the HECU that infiltrate Black Mesa to eliminate anyone associated with the Resonance Cascade. They are seen throughout most of the earthbound levels. Note.pngNote:If you have a HECU marine prop_ragdoll, you can change the appearance of it by naming it Gasmask_grunt. This will make the ragdoll have a gasmask and sometimes have gloves.
Note.pngNote:The npc_sentry_ceiling will not attack the HECU, instead, you will need to use an ai_relationship if you want it to attack.
